The State of Microsoft .NET Web Development in 2018
The State of Microsoft .NET Web Development in 2018

.NET is certainly one of the most valued of all Microsoft technology solutions. The popular framework is known for being secure and flexible, in addition to supporting a large number of libraries and programming languages. The web development sector has been going through steady changes since the initial release of .NET two decades ago. 

The demand for ASP.NET development services skyrocketed owing to Microsoft’s consistent efforts to reinvent the potential of its technologies and the support of its huge open source community. Microsoft’s present stand to support open source technologies has also done a lot of good for the developer community.

The rise of ASP.NET Core

ASP.NET Core 2.0 is gaining momentum offering a plethora of benefits for developers including great tooling improvements and complete support for .NET Core 2.0. Building rich web apps with ASP.NET Core 2.0 is now easier and more interesting.

Here are a few of its notable features.

  • Full support for .NET Standard 2.0 in addition to .NET Core 2.0
  • Full feature web framework
  • Combined MVC and Web API stack
  • Razor page support
  • CLI or Visual Tooling
  • Backwards compatibility for .NET 4.6.1
  • New set of project templates
  • Improved logging, Azure tooling, and app insight
  • More support for client-side JavaScript SPA frameworks

That said, let’s take a look at the many advantages of using .NET Core.

  • .NET Core has a short learning curve with a syntax which is simple to understand and learn.
  • The ASP.NET Core templates could use Bootstrap layouts and npm to pull in client-side libraries making this framework very versatile.
  • Great developer tools including Visual Studio which is one of the best IDEs available now featuring a code editor that supports debugging, profiling, git integration, unit testing, and more.
  • Vast set of base class libraries
  • .NET Core is open source, which means the code is open and can be refined by anyone in the open source community. The contributions from the community makes the framework even better.

Conclusion

Almost every software development company in Dubai offering web development services use .NET framework today. Its continuous evolution and the sheer number of changes it undergoes make it one of the most preferred choices for developers. The open development processes and transparent roadmaps all point to an exciting future for .NET this year, and hopefully in the coming years.